Output 8f3b9f95c90497567c694cfec02ad2fc77ef7632c1bdaaef7eab4332710fd508:0

value
39881913
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 14a158993644ef140816a6a59a0f7c43558a2d63 OP_EQUALVERIFY OP_CHECKSIG
address
12t5oMqmWfLkhvEp8ev8LFnmpevFBjktou
transaction
8f3b9f95c90497567c694cfec02ad2fc77ef7632c1bdaaef7eab4332710fd508
confirmations
516639
spent
true